Least Common Multiple of 73155 and 73170 with GCF Formula

The formula of LCM is LCM(a,b) = ( a × b) / GCF(a,b).
We need to calculate greatest common factor 73155 and 73170, than apply into the LCM equation.

GCF(73155,73170) = 15
LCM(73155,73170) = ( 73155 × 73170) / 15
LCM(73155,73170) = 5352751350 / 15
LCM(73155,73170) = 356850090
